Transaction f688069b154fc79755637e3578a80982e433f5db1c15d067b29e575507911e46
1 Input
1 Output
-
f688069b154fc79755637e3578a80982e433f5db1c15d067b29e575507911e46:0
- value
- 19458632
- script pubkey
- OP_0 OP_PUSHBYTES_20 5d6b0f5b45f742beef0c4c243879fd823f1da8f4
- address
- bc1qt44s7k697aptamcvfsjrs70asgl3m285pc7cga